Title: Motorsports Team Coordinator Department: Engineering Campus: Hardin Valley Closing Date: Open Until Filled Type of Appointment: Temporary Part-time Pay Rate: $19.34 per hour Work Hours: 30 hours per week Position Summary: The Motorsports Team Coordinator will oversee the operations of our student-led Formula SAE (FSAE) team. This individual will act as the primary administrative authority for the team, maintain regular communication with student leaders, monitor progress, and ensure the team stays on schedule. Rather than providing hands-on technical design or fabrication, the Team Coordinator will assist with logistics, planning, and administrative tasks while providing guidance when needed. The ideal candidate fosters student accountability while guiding the team through the complexities of a large-scale technical project. One of the main goals of this role is to help maintain long-term sustainability for the team, so future students can continue to be involved and benefit from the experience.
